Minnie Kocher, the wife of Albert Kocher, was born August 15, 1871, at Onaga, Kansas, and died after a short illness, at her home near Onaga on May 22, 1943, at the age of 71 years, 9 months and 7 days.

When yet young she became a member of the Lutheran Church through the rite of Confirmation, and remained a member of that church until the end of her life.

On March 3, 1898 she was married to Albert Kocher of Onaga. This union was blessed with eight children. She lived near Onaga all her life, and during that long time she gained many friends.

Remaining to mourn her departure are her husband, Albert Kocher; eight children: Carl;, of Onaga, Katherine of Kansas City, Missouri; Bernard of Salina, Herman and Louise of Onaga, Margaret Vaughn of Kansas City, Missouri, Arnold of Saline, and Harvey of Onaga; also eight grandchildren, two sisters, and a number of other relatives and a host of friends.

Funeral services were held on Monday afternoon, May 24, in the St. Luke's Lutheran Church, Rev. O. H. Praeuner officiating.

The remains were laid to rest in the St. Luke's Lutheran Cemetery.
